About the Big Earth Data format

Big Earth Data is a peer-reviewed journal published by Taylor & Francis, covering Remote Sensing in Agriculture, Geographic Information Systems Studies, Climate variability and models.

PublisherTaylor & Francis
Reference styleAuthor–year (Chicago, T&F)
Author–year — (Smith, 2023) in the text
Smith, Ada, Ben Jones, and Cara Lee. 2023. "A Representative Article Title." Big Earth Data 12 (3): 45–58.

What reference style does Big Earth Data use?
Big Earth Data uses Author–year (Chicago, T&F) references, shown as author–year markers such as (Smith, 2023) in the text. DocuGuru formats every in-text citation and the reference list in this exact style automatically. A reference appears like this: Smith, Ada, Ben Jones, and Cara Lee. 2023. "A Representative Article Title." Big Earth Data 12 (3): 45–58.
